Anders Breivik played violent video games a lot. He also murdered 77 people in Norway. Can we draw a conclusion from those two data points? I know many people who play lots of violent video games and haven't murdered anyone.
Norwegian anthropologist Thomas Hylland Eriksen said, "He does not seem to be very successful at distinguishing between the virtual reality of 'World of Warcraft' and other video games and reality."
Anders Breivik used the alias "Andersnordic" to blame the maker of the video game for his obesity, baldness and pale complexion.

Anders Breivik, the right-wing extremist who has confessed to killing 77 people during a murder spree in Norway last summer, played the violent computer game World of Warcraft nearly seven hours a day for several consecutive months before his attack, prosecutors say.

Look, children have been playing games that involved "killing" from the begining of society. primitive man played games of hunting and warfare, later man played games of combat and weapon skill building and we all played games like cowboy and indian, cops and robbers and GI Joe. When kids turned to video games and became less socially interactive the skill sets changed but the goals never did.
Look I have seen children and even adults get into fit fights over board games or card games. Violent tendiencies are not created by games but the lack of social interation videos allow can mitigate a person's ability to understand what is and is not socially acceptable. If you do not have to learn how to give up some of your desires and needs in order to fit in with teh desired group then you never lean to accept others as having a value equal to your own
